How to Identify and Avoid Problem Gambling Patterns
Recognizing problem gambling patterns is essential for maintaining a healthy relationship with casino activities. While gambling can be an enjoyable pastime, unchecked behavior may lead to financial loss, emotional distress, and social issues. Early identification of warning signs enables individuals to seek help before the consequences become severe. Understanding the triggers and habits associated with problematic gambling is the first step toward prevention and recovery.
Common indicators of problem gambling include chasing losses, gambling to escape stress, and betting more than one can afford to lose. These behaviors often escalate over time, causing significant disruption to daily life. Awareness of these patterns can help players set clear limits and employ self-control strategies. Engaging with support networks and using responsible gambling tools provided by many casinos are practical methods to mitigate risk and promote safer gambling habits.

How to Analyze Casino Reviews Before Playing
Choosing the right casino to play at requires careful analysis of available reviews. Not all casinos provide the same experience, and reading reviews helps identify trusted platforms that offer fair play, secure transactions, and quality customer service. Understanding what to look for in these reviews can save players time and protect them from unreliable operators.
When examining casino reviews, focus on several key factors: licensing and regulation, game variety, bonus terms, payment methods, and user feedback. A reputable review will include detailed information about the casino’s credentials, withdrawal speeds, and fairness of games. Additionally, player comments often reveal common issues or praise, giving you insights beyond the official descriptions. Comparing multiple reviews from different sources ensures a balanced perspective.
